Physical Inspection of Your Boost iPhone 16 128GB
Begin with a detailed physical check of your device. Look for any signs of damage or wear that could affect its value or functionality.
- Screen: Check for scratches, cracks, or dead pixels.
- Body: Inspect for dents, scratches, or other damage.
- Buttons and Ports: Ensure all buttons (volume, power) work properly and ports (charging, headphone) are clean and functional.
- Camera Lenses: Look for scratches or smudges that could affect photo quality.
Functional Testing of Your iPhone 16
Next, verify that all features and hardware components are working correctly.
- Display: Turn on the device and check for responsiveness and display issues.
- Touch Screen: Test for responsiveness across the entire screen.
- Battery: Check battery health in settings and observe charging functionality.
- Sound: Test speakers and headphone jack (if applicable).
- Camera: Take photos and videos to ensure clarity and proper operation.
- Connectivity: Test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and cellular connection.
- Buttons and Sensors: Confirm all physical buttons and sensors (like Face ID) work correctly.

Assessing the Overall Condition
Combine your physical and functional assessments to determine the overall condition of your Boost iPhone 16 128GB. Use a grading scale such as:
- Excellent: No visible damage, fully functional, and recent software update.
- Good: Minor scratches or signs of use, but no major issues.
- Fair: Noticeable wear or minor functional issues that do not impair use.
- Poor: Significant damage or multiple issues requiring repair.
Additional Tips Before Selling
To maximize your device’s resale value, consider the following:
- Clean the device: Remove dirt, smudges, and fingerprints.
- Gather accessories: Include original charger, cables, and box if available.
- Document the condition: Take clear photos and note any defects or issues.
- Reset to factory settings: Protect your personal data before selling.
